Termination by the Executive for any Reason Sample Clauses

Termination by the Executive for any Reason. The Executive may terminate their employment hereunder at any time for any reason whatsoever by giving the Company written notice of the intent to do so at least thirty (30) days prior to the date on which the proposed termination is to be effective.

Termination by the Executive for any Reason. (a) Upon a termination of the Executive’s employment hereunder in accordance with the terms and provisions of Section 7.2, the Executive shall be entitled to receive all Accrued Salary and Benefits calculated through the date such termination is effective. The Executive thereafter shall not be entitled to receive any additional compensation from the Company.
Termination by the Executive for any Reason. The Executive may terminate her employment at any time for any reason.

  • Termination by the Executive Without Good Reason The Executive may terminate his employment on his own initiative for any reason upon 30 days’ prior written notice to the Company; provided, however, that during such notice period, the Executive shall reasonably cooperate with the Company (at no cost to the Executive) in minimizing the effects of such termination on the Company Group. Such termination shall have the same consequences as a termination for Cause under Section 6.2.

  • Voluntary Termination by the Executive Notwithstanding anything in this Agreement to the contrary, the Executive may, upon not less than thirty (30) days' written notice to the Company, voluntarily terminate employment for any reason (including retirement under the terms of the Company's retirement plan as in effect from time to time).
